1 High performance Computing Applied to a Saltwater Intrusion Numerical Model E. Canot IRISA/CNRS J. Erhel IRISA/INRIA Rennes C. de Dieuleveult IRISA/INRIA.

Slides:



Advertisements
Similar presentations
1 A parallel software for a saltwater intrusion problem E. Canot IRISA/CNRS J. Erhel IRISA/INRIA Rennes C. de Dieuleveult IRISA/INRIA Rennes.
Advertisements

A parallel scientific software for heterogeneous hydrogeoloy
Numerical simulation of solute transport in heterogeneous porous media A. Beaudoin, J.-R. de Dreuzy, J. Erhel Workshop High Performance Computing at LAMSIN.
Reactive transport A COMPARISON BETWEEN SEQUENTIAL ITERATIVE AND GLOBAL METHODS FOR A REACTIVE TRANSPORT NUMERICAL MODEL J. Erhel INRIA - RENNES - FRANCE.
1 Modal methods for 3D heterogeneous neutronics core calculations using the mixed dual solver MINOS. Application to complex geometries and parallel processing.
Sparse linear solvers applied to parallel simulations of underground flow in porous and fractured media A. Beaudoin 1, J.R. De Dreuzy 2, J. Erhel 1 and.
Outline Overview of Pipe Flow CFD Process ANSYS Workbench
How to solve a large sparse linear system arising in groundwater and CFD problems J. Erhel, team Sage, INRIA, Rennes, France Joint work with A. Beaudoin.
1 Numerical Simulation for Flow in 3D Highly Heterogeneous Fractured Media H. Mustapha J. Erhel J.R. De Dreuzy H. Mustapha INRIA, SIAM Juin 2005.
Sandia is a multiprogram laboratory operated by Sandia Corporation, a Lockheed Martin Company, for the United States Department of Energy under contract.
HYDROGEOLOGIE ECOULEMENT EN MILIEU HETEROGENE J. Erhel – INRIA / RENNES J-R. de Dreuzy – CAREN / RENNES P. Davy – CAREN / RENNES Chaire UNESCO - Calcul.
1 Modélisation et simulation appliquées au suivi de pollution des nappes phréatiques Jocelyne Erhel Équipe Sage, INRIA Rennes Mesures, Modélisation et.
Inversion of coupled groundwater flow and heat transfer M. Bücker 1, V.Rath 2 & A. Wolf 1 1 Scientific Computing, 2 Applied Geophysics Bommerholz ,
A modified Lagrangian-volumes method to simulate nonlinearly and kinetically adsorbing solute transport in heterogeneous media J.-R. de Dreuzy, Ph. Davy,
Advanced CFD Analysis of Aerodynamics Using CFX
Numerical Simulation of Dispersion of Density Dependent Transport in Heterogeneous Stochastic Media MSc.Nooshin Bahar Supervisor: Prof. Manfred Koch.
High performance flow simulation in discrete fracture networks and heterogeneous porous media Jocelyne Erhel INRIA Rennes Jean-Raynald de Dreuzy Geosciences.
Ground-Water Flow and Solute Transport for the PHAST Simulator Ken Kipp and David Parkhurst.
Extending the capability of TOUGHREACT simulator using parallel computing Application to environmental problems.
Aspects of Conditional Simulation and estimation of hydraulic conductivity in coastal aquifers" Luit Jan Slooten.
20th-SWIMH.F.Abd-Elhamid1 An Investigation into Control of Saltwater Intrusion Considering the Effects of Climate Change and Sea Level Rise H. F. Abd-Elhamid.
An efficient parallel particle tracker For advection-diffusion simulations In heterogeneous porous media Euro-Par 2007 IRISA - Rennes August 2007.
Multilevel Incomplete Factorizations for Non-Linear FE problems in Geomechanics DMMMSA – University of Padova Department of Mathematical Methods and Models.
Avoiding Communication in Sparse Iterative Solvers Erin Carson Nick Knight CS294, Fall 2011.
6/22/2005ICS'20051 Parallel Sparse LU Factorization on Second-class Message Passing Platforms Kai Shen University of Rochester.
D. Zuzio* J-L. Estivalezes* *ONERA/DMAE, 2 av. Édouard Belin, Toulouse, France Simulation of a Rayleigh-Taylor instability with five levels of adaptive.
Finite Difference Methods to Solve the Wave Equation To develop the governing equation, Sum the Forces The Wave Equation Equations of Motion.
Direct and iterative sparse linear solvers applied to groundwater flow simulations Matrix Analysis and Applications October 2007.
1 Parallel Simulations of Underground Flow in Porous and Fractured Media H. Mustapha 1,2, A. Beaudoin 1, J. Erhel 1 and J.R. De Dreuzy IRISA – INRIA.
Density-Dependent Flows Primary source: User’s Guide to SEAWAT: A Computer Program for Simulation of Three-Dimensional Variable-Density Ground- Water Flow.
MUMPS A Multifrontal Massively Parallel Solver IMPLEMENTATION Distributed multifrontal.
Fast Thermal Analysis on GPU for 3D-ICs with Integrated Microchannel Cooling Zhuo Fen and Peng Li Department of Electrical and Computer Engineering, {Michigan.
Numerical simulation of the Fluid-Structure Interaction in stented aneurysms M.-A. FERNÁNDEZ, J.-F. GERBEAU, J. MURA INRIA / REO Team Paris-Rocquencourt.
A comparison between a direct and a multigrid sparse linear solvers for highly heterogeneous flux computations A. Beaudoin, J.-R. De Dreuzy and J. Erhel.
ParCFD Parallel computation of pollutant dispersion in industrial sites Julien Montagnier Marc Buffat David Guibert.
Stokes flow in porous media
Naples, Florida, June Tidal Effects on Transient Dispersion of Simulated Contaminant Concentrations in Coastal Aquifers Ivana La Licata Christian.
1 The reactive transport benchmark J. Carrayrou Institut de Mécanique des Fluides et des Solides, Laboratoire d’Hydrologie et de Géochimie de Strasbourg,
On the Use of Sparse Direct Solver in a Projection Method for Generalized Eigenvalue Problems Using Numerical Integration Takamitsu Watanabe and Yusaku.
Journées Scientifiques du GNR MOMAS, novembre 2009DM2S/SFME/LSET 1 MPCube Development Ph. Montarnal, Th. Abballe, F. Caro, E. Laucoin, DEN Saclay.
FSI for Assessing Nerve Injury During Whiplash Motion
Simulating complex surface flow by Smoothed Particle Hydrodynamics & Moving Particle Semi-implicit methods Benlong Wang Kai Gong Hua Liu
Outline Numerical implementation Diagnosis of difficulties
Numerical Investigation of Hydrogen Release from Varying Diameter Exit
Case Study in Computational Science & Engineering - Lecture 5 1 Iterative Solution of Linear Systems Jacobi Method while not converged do { }
Domain Decomposition in High-Level Parallelizaton of PDE codes Xing Cai University of Oslo.
Cracow Grid Workshop, November 5-6, 2001 Concepts for implementing adaptive finite element codes for grid computing Krzysztof Banaś, Joanna Płażek Cracow.
COMPUTER SIMULATION OF BLOOD FLOW WITH COMPLIANT WALLS  ITC Software All rights reserved.
Systems of Equations Standards: MCC9-12.A.REI.5-12
MA/CS 471 Lecture 15, Fall 2002 Introduction to Graph Partitioning.
SAN DIEGO SUPERCOMPUTER CENTER at the UNIVERSITY OF CALIFORNIA, SAN DIEGO Advanced User Support for MPCUGLES code at University of Minnesota October 09,
Lattice Boltzmann Simulation of Fluid Flows M.J. Pattison & S. Banerjee MetaHeuristics LLC Santa Barbara, CA
HYDROGRID J. Erhel – October 2004 Components and grids  Deployment of components  CORBA model  Parallel components with GridCCM Homogeneous cluster.
A Parallel Hierarchical Solver for the Poisson Equation Seung Lee Deparment of Mechanical Engineering
Adaptive grid refinement. Adaptivity in Diffpack Error estimatorError estimator Adaptive refinementAdaptive refinement A hierarchy of unstructured gridsA.
1 Simulation of the Couplex 1 test case and preliminary results of Couplex 2 H. HOTEIT 1,2, Ph. ACKERER 1, R. MOSE 1 1 IMFS STRASBOURG 2 IRISA RENNES 1.
High Performance Computing Seminar
A Scalable Parallel Preconditioned Sparse Linear System Solver Murat ManguoğluMiddle East Technical University, Turkey Joint work with: Ahmed Sameh Purdue.
Parallel Direct Methods for Sparse Linear Systems
Hui Liu University of Calgary
Xing Cai University of Oslo
Free vs. Forced Convection
Differential Equations
Department of Mathematics
Linear Systems November 28, 2016.
Meros: Software for Block Preconditioning the Navier-Stokes Equations
GENERAL VIEW OF KRATOS MULTIPHYSICS
Differential Equations
Ph.D. Thesis Numerical Solution of PDEs and Their Object-oriented Parallel Implementations Xing Cai October 26, 1998.
Numerical Investigation of Hydrogen Release from Varying Diameter Exit
Presentation transcript:

1 High performance Computing Applied to a Saltwater Intrusion Numerical Model E. Canot IRISA/CNRS J. Erhel IRISA/INRIA Rennes C. de Dieuleveult IRISA/INRIA Rennes

2 Outline Context Model and Test Cases Coupled Model Test Cases : Henry and Elder Parallel performances Presentation Results Conclusion

3 Context Effect of pumping in coastal aquifers Necessity to predict the evolution of the water supply. Context

4 Presentation of the software Based on TVDV-2D software developped at IMFS in Strasbourg Simulation of density driven coupled flow and transport in a porous media Originally sequential Coupled Model

5 Model FLOW TRANSPORTconvection dispersion Coupled Model

6 Strong Coupling Concentration Time n FLOWTRANSPORT Velocity Density Time n+1 Coupled Model

7 Henry Stable test case Test Cases

8 Elder Unstable test case Test Cases

9 First parallel version (v1) Parallel performances Parallel linear solvers

10 Parallel sparse solver Use of MUMPS (« MUltifrontal Massively Parallel Solver »), a free package for solving linear systems of equations Ax=b Adapted for sparse unsymmetric, and symmetric definite positive matrices. Parallel performances

11 Global parallelisation (v2) Partitioning mesh thanks to METIS, a free package for partitioning graphs, meshes and for producing fill reducing orderings for sparse matrices. Partitioning example with 5 parts Better data distribution. Parallel performances

12 Time step number 1 processor2 processors Iteration number Time step (in day) Iteration number Time step (in day) 1101/4101/4 2 to 7121/4121/4 826 (no convergence) 1/4111/4 1/81/4 Results Due to the convergence criterion Elder (mesh 256x160) Sensitivity to convergence criterion

13 Sensitivity to convergence criterion Results Elder (mesh 256x160), time step number 8

14 Wall clock (in seconds) Number of processors Results Results for the first version (v1) Henry (mesh 510x254)

15 Number of processors Results Results for the second version (v2) Wall clock (in seconds) Henry (mesh 510x254)

16 Conclusion - Perspectives 3D geometry Adaptative mesh Improved coupling Conclusion